Renfrewshire Council is committed to providing a part time pre-school place for every three and four year old in the term after their third birthday.

There are also a small number of nursery places for children aged three and under.

You can apply for a nursery place by contacting your local nursery or printing off and completing the application below and sending it to the nursery you want your child to go to.

Application for delayed admission to primary school - An extra year of pre-school education

Under current legislation, if your child is aged between four and a half and five years old at the start of the school session you have a choice about when your child starts primary school. If your child's birthday is in January or February, you have the right to delay entry to primary school and to have a free pre-school education place for an extra year.

You can also request delayed entry to school if your child's birthday is from September to December, there is no automatic right to an extra pre-school education place in these circumstances and the decision to provide an extra year will be made by the local authority in the best interests of the child.

You can apply for an additional year of pre-school education by contacting the nursery your child attends or by printing off and completing the form below and sending it to the nursery.
